DO:
Expect a mild headache
Stay upright for 4 hours after your treatment
Use clean hands when touching your skin
Take paracetamol (not aspirin or ibuprofen) if you experience discomfort
Be patient – results can take 3–14 days to fully develop
AVOID:
Rubbing, massaging or applying pressure to the treated area for 24 hours
Wearing makeup for at least 6 hours (ideally until the next day)
Strenuous exercise for 24 hours
Saunas or hot environments for 48 hours
Facials for 2 weeks

Understanding Fine Lines & Wrinkles
Dynamic lines are lines that appear or become more noticeable when you move your facial muscles; for example, when smiling, frowning or raising your eyebrows. Over time, repeated facial movement can contribute to these lines becoming more noticeable. When the face is relaxed, these lines may initially disappear or appear much softer.
Static lines are lines that remain visible even when your face is at rest. They can develop when dynamic lines become more established over time, alongside changes in the skin such as reduced collagen and elastin, decreased hydration and repeated exposure to environmental factors.
How the Face Changes With Age
Facial ageing is more than just changes in the skin. As we age, gradual changes occur across several layers of the face.
These can include:
Skin: Collagen, elastin and hydration levels gradually change, affecting firmness, texture and elasticity.
Fat: Facial fat compartments can change in size and position, altering facial contours and support.
Muscle: Repeated muscle activity contributes to the development and progression of expression lines.
Bone: Gradual changes to the underlying facial structure can influence the way the overlying tissues are supported.
Together, these changes can contribute to lines, wrinkles, changes in facial definition and shifts in the way light and shadow fall across the face.
